碱性中包化渣剂的应用试验  

Applied experiments of basic tundish slagging agent in continuous casting

摘  要:为了解决普通覆盖剂在连铸生产中遇到的中包渣易结壳、中包前期钢水增碳较重的问题,对选用的碱性中包化渣剂进行了应用可行性分析和工业应用试验。结果表明,碱性中包化渣剂的化渣效果较好,中包前三炉钢水平均增碳由原来的0.028%降低到0.002 3%,铸坯酸溶铝损失率降低4.94%,中包渣中吸收氧化铝夹杂量增加1.14%,保温性能、耗量和减缓耐材侵蚀方面均好于普通覆盖剂。In order to solve problems of covering flux in continuous casting, such as slagging-formed crust in the tundish and serious carbon pick-up of molten steel, the possibility analysis and industrial experiments concerning the application of basic tundish slagging agent were carried out. The results show that the basic slagging agent was good in its performance. The average carbon pick-up of molten steel in the tundish for the first three heats decreased from 0. 028 -%00 to 0. 002 3 %. The loss ratio of acid soluble aluminum of billet reduced by 4. 94 %, and absorbed alumina inclusion of slagging agenton increased by 1.14 %. The basic slagging agent is much better than ordinary covering flux in insulation property, consumption, and erosion to refractory.
